Oak Alley Foundation: A National Historic Landmark

Oak Alley Plantation is a historic site located between Baton Rouge and New Orleans. The Foundation owns and operates the mansion and the surrounding 28 historic acres. Visitors explore its over 200 years of history. Oak Alley Foundation's mission is to preserve a piece of the Louisiana Plantation culture of the 19th century. Programs and exhibits are designed to teach visitors from all over the world about life during this period. There is an emphasis on a portrayal of conditions under which slaves lived and worked.
